    Subject[PATCH v1 2/2] usb: core: enable remote wakeup function for usb controller
    Date
    The remote wake up function is a regular function on usb device and
    I think keeping it enabled by default will make the usb application
    more convenient and usb device remote wake up function keep enabled
    that ask usb controller remote wake up was enabled at first.

    This patch only enable wake up on usb root hub device, among which,
    usb3.0 root hub doesn't be set wakeup node property but use command
    USB_INTRF_FUNC_SUSPEND to enable remote wake up function.
